I don't want start a circular argument here {no pun intended} but how well does the "button" flywheel perform in a trail riding situation where the engine is put under vastly varying loads in succession? Does it tend to stall easier or because of the lighter flywheel does it perform better because of the ability to rev quicker?

Holyman, jamoffit has just posted a reply to a topic that you have subscribed to titled "Banshee / Yamaha Rz350 Ypvs Conversion Kit". ---------------------------------------------------------------------- Note that late model Production RZ's are already 60+ HP (documented at 63HP). Below is the formula for a race proven, very reliable 75+HP -Matched bored 38mm TZ350 Mikuni VM38SS -Modified TZ350F Ported Reed Cages with modified 6 Pedal Carbon Reeds -Custom Billet intakes with built-in cross over -85 RZ CDI, Ignition coil, Magneto/Stator Set, Lightened Flywheel & Adjustable Stator plate 5 degrees advanced Timing -High Output Race Ported RZ cylinders machined to accommodate 38mm carbs -Ceramic and Graphite coated 64mm Cast 'ART' pistons, pins, rings & cylinders -Port Matched Modified / Lifted piston skirts -Modified Pro Design Cool Head with 18cc domes -Ported Cases with RZ Shift Drum and Forks -Cryogenic treated Crank assembly with TZ big-end pins and Roller bearings & 115mm Rods: equates to 373cc Requires Cometic long rod Base Gasket -Rods have been modified with larger oil galleries -Modified Hinson Clutch assembly with a 8 plate setup fitted with a clutch center bearing conversion -RZ Tranny with Undercut gears -Jim Lomas GP Exhaust w\ Carbon silencers Countless hours invested. Requires 105+ Octane... This is a full race effort motor and only happy between 9-11500 rpm. Pushes over 75+HP and is very reliable, over 1200 race miles thus far. ASSA, ARHMA AFM and CCS Legal for Twins, slaughters SV650's. Not streetable. Have you guys ever considered using the RD400's engine, strong compact design & you can double the HP if you push the envelop. Although it is aircooled, it is the grandfather of the Banshee. I have also built complete TZ350F-H Motors with over 90+hp.

  18. your shocks are probably worn out. if all the shocks are original, his are a minimum of 5 years newer than yours. The J and A arms have the same travel since the length is the same. Get some newer used shocks and you should be good to go.
